Warner Robins police chief ‘stands in firm support’ of officers involved in fatal shootout
By macon.com/ - Becky Purser
Published: 03/13/2013

GEORGIA - WARNER ROBINS -- Police Chief Brett Evans issued a written statement Tuesday afternoon supporting officers involved in a Sunday night incident that erupted into a fatal shootout with police.

Anthony “Tony” Rawls, 50, a lieutenant with the state Department of Corrections who worked at Macon State Prison, was shot and killed in the exchange.

“I stand in firm support of our officers and believe the investigation will show that they acted within the agency’s policies and procedures in accordance with the law,” Evans stated.

Shortly before 8 p.m. on Sunday, officers responded to a 911 call from 106 Huntwood Lane, where they were told a man was armed with a gun and threatening his wife, according to police.

As officers approached the house, police say, shots were exchanged between officers and the man, who was pronounced dead at the scene. One of the officers received minor injuries, according to police.
